Q: What do you get if you divide c by x and then divide result by v?

How do you convert 15.8 Fahrenheit to Celsius?

-- Take the Fahrenheit temp: ( 15.8 )-- Subtract 32 from it: ( 15.8 - 32 = -16.2 )-- Multiply the result by 5: ( -16.2 x 5 = -81 )-- Divide that result by 9: ( -81 / 9 = -9 )The same temperature given in Celsius is -9 .

How would you actually find the sum of 1492 14 and 49 in two different ways using only Roman numerals in step by step stages throughout both calculations giving reasons why?

1492 = MCDXCII14 = XIV49 = XLIXSum: 1492 + 14 + 49 = MCDXCII + XIV + XLIXExpected answer: 1555 = MDLVMethod 1Similar to the decimal system. Work from the right and examine the unit portions of each value. Expand the individual values, cancel out the positive and negative values and sum the remainder. If the result is greater than or equal to X, carry the X(s) and leave the remainder (the units). Repeat for the tens portion, the hundreds and the thousands. Combine the answers.Start with the units:II + IV + IX =I + I - I + V - I + X = (expanded)I + I - I + V - I + X = (cancel out similar + and - values)V + X =XV =V (carry X)Now the tens (with carry):XC + X + XL ( + X) =- X + C + X - X + L + X = (expanded)- X + C + X - X + L + X = (cancel out similar + and - values)C + L =CL =L (carry C)And the hundreds (with carry):CD ( + C ) =- C + D + C = (expanded)- C + D + C = (cancel out similar + and - values)D (no carry)And finally the thousands (no carry):MCombine the results:M + D + L + V =MDLVMethod 2Combine the numbers into a single number and expand the individual values. Cancel all similar positive and negative values. Then sort in descending order. Simplify if necessary.MCDXCII + XIV + XLIX =MCDXCIIXIVXLIX = (combined)M - C + D - X + C + I + I + X - I + V - X + L - I + X = (expanded)M - C + D - X + C + I + I + X - I + V - X + L - I + X = (cancel out similar + and - values)M + D + V + L = (unsorted)M + D + L + V = (sorted)MDLV

What are two ways of adding together 19 49 and 99 using Roman numerals throughout both calculations?

19 = XIX 49 = XLIX 99 = XCIX Expected result is 167 = CLXVII Method 1: Convert subtractive pairs so IV becomes IIII, XL becomes XXXX and XC becomes LXXXX. Then sort values in descending order of value, grouping C, X and I in groups of 5, and L and V in groups of 2, then reduce these groups so that IIIII becomes V, VV becomes X, XXXXX becomes L and LL becomes C. XIX + XLIX + XCIX = XVIIII + XXXXVIIII + LXXXXVIIII = L + XXXXX + XXXX + VV + V + IIIII + IIIII + II = L + XXXXX + XXXX + VV + VV + V + II = L + XXXXX + XXXXX + X + V + II = LL + L + X + V + II = C + L + X + V + II = CLXVII Method 2: Expand all symbols into positive and negative symbols, sort by absolute value, cancel out any similar values with opposing signs. Convert higher values to lower values as required. XIX + XLIX + XCIX = X - I + X - X + L - I + X - X + C - I + X = C + L + X + X - X + X - X + X - I - I - I = C + L + X + X - I - I - I = C + L + X + V + V - I - I - I = C + L + X + V + I + I + I + I + I - I - I - I = C + L + X + V + I + I = CLXVII
